Alcoholic cardiomyopathy is a weakening of the heart muscle linked to prolonged and excessive alcohol consumption. Over time, the heart loses strength to pump blood efficiently.
Common symptoms: shortness of breath on exertion or at rest, fatigue, palpitations, and swelling in the legs or ankles due to fluid retention. The discomfort may set in gradually.
Common causes: it is associated with the toxic effect that alcohol has on the heart's fibers when consumption is high and sustained over the years.
Which specialist treats it? The one who studies this condition is the cardiologist; the general practitioner can guide the first evaluation and, in the presence of an acute condition, the emergency physician provides immediate care. If difficulty breathing or persistent palpitations appear, it is advisable to seek a cardiology review.
